Community Land Week 2022

Community Land Week ran from the 8th to the 16th of October for the fourth Scotland-wide celebration of community landowners.

The Urban Gathering 2022 in Pictures

On Friday the 22nd of April 2022, The Community Ownership Hub and Community Land Scotland hosted The Urban Gathering at The Kinning Park Complex.

Funding Available 22/23: Community Engagement Support

We are asking for expressions of interest in community engagement support. Groups applying should be exploring owning land or buildings, and be getting ready to explain their plans in 2022.
